Reporting to: General Counsel/Head of Legal

Job Purpose:

To provide expert legal advice, support, and risk assessment across all business units of the group holding company. The Legal Advisor will ensure that all business activities comply with applicable laws and regulations in the GCC and other relevant jurisdictions where the group operates.

Key Responsibilities:

Corporate & Commercial Law

  • Draft, review, and negotiate commercial contracts including shareholder agreements, joint ventures, M&A documents, service agreements, NDAs, etc.
  • Advise on company formation, restructuring, governance, and compliance across all entities under the group.
  • Manage legal due diligence for acquisitions, divestments, and partnerships.

Regulatory Compliance

  • Monitor and interpret evolving local and international regulations, including those related to corporate governance, financial regulations, data protection, and foreign investment.
  • Liaise with regulators, legal consultants, and external counsel to ensure the group meets all compliance requirements.
  • Oversee and manage litigation and arbitration proceedings.
  • Work with external legal counsel on disputes involving the company.
  • Assist in resolving legal disputes before they escalate into litigation.
  • Identify legal risks and proactively propose strategies to mitigate them.
  • Ensure legal risks are integrated into the company’s enterprise risk management framework.

Legal Documentation & Policy

  • Develop and maintain a legal document repository for group-wide use.
  • Draft and update internal legal policies, templates, and procedures.
  • Train business units on legal best practices and contractual obligations.

Qualifications & Experience:

  • Education: Bachelor’s Degree in Law (LLB) required; Master’s degree or legal specialization (e.g., LLM, MBA with legal focus) preferred.
  • Experience:
  • Minimum 7–10 years of legal experience, with at least 3–5 years in the GCC.
  • Prior in-house experience with a group holding company or multinational organization is highly preferred.
  • Experience in sectors such as real estate, hospitality or investment management is advantageous.
  • Strong commercial acumen and ability to align legal strategies with business objectives.
  • Excellent drafting, negotiation, and communication skills.
  • Bilingual (Arabic and English) strongly preferred.
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ced, multicultural environment.
  • High level of integrity and professional ethics.

Remuneration:

  • Competitive salary package (tax-free, if applicable in jurisdiction).
  • Annual bonus based on performance.
  • Benefits including housing allowance, education, transport, insurance, and annual flights.

The Role
• Lead legal advisory role for the delivery of PPP projects. • Responsible for drafting bidding documents and relevant legal agreements. • Undertaking legal due diligence. • To assess the applicable legal framework and highlight any legal considerations. • To analyze the sector and environmental legislation and regulations. • To identify key legal and regulatory risks for the PPP project. • To participate in the development and preparation of the PPP procurement documents in coordination with all relevant stakeholders and the Authority. • To carry out risk analysis and mitigation. • To conduct expression of interest, request for qualification, and request for proposal evaluations. • To assist in preparing scoring mechanisms for markups. • To prepare responses for all legal clarifications being raised during the procurement of the project as a PPP. • To prepare and present evaluation reports and committee recommendation papers to the Authority and relevant committee for approval and address any comments. • To prepare the draft PPP agreement and associated transaction agreements in compliance with the PPP Law for each PPP Project, • To review any markups to the PPP agreement and advise the Authority on potential risks and negotiation strategies. • To identify legal negotiation points and assist in the preparation of negotiation strategy and execute legal negotiations with the preferred bidder or any other bidder as per agreement with the Authority. • To advise on the PPP agreement, bid documents, and negotiation with bidders. • To prepare additional schedules based on the outcome of the negotiation strategy. • To lead the compilation of the PPP agreement in preparation for signing and coordinate all relevant activities with the preferred bidder and the Authority including the Clients' department. • To provide support to the Authority’s PPP team where required. • To provide day-to-day contractual support to the Authority’s PPP team as and when required. • Attendance at relevant meetings.

Requirements
• Law degree obtained from universities identified in the World Higher Education Database (WHED) published by the International Association of Universities. • More than 15 years of practical and relevant experience since obtaining the educational qualifications specified, with a minimum of 7 years of specialized experience in transaction advisory and PPPs. • Minimum of 7 years of experience working in North America, W. Europe, UK, Australia, or New Zealand or an equivalent developed country or GCC. • Minimum 7 years of experience with roles similar to the proposed role. • In-depth knowledge of PPP procedures and processes. • In-depth understanding of sector and environmental legislation and regulations. • Demonstrable track record in the delivery of large PPP projects. • Strong communication skills both orally and written to build and maintain excellent working relationships within complex structures, both internally and with various project stakeholders. Desirable Requirements: • Master’s degree in a relevant field. • Highly desirable to have Chartership, Licensed or Professional Certification obtained from internationally recognized professional institutions or organizations. • Highly desirable to have Arabic language skills. • Highly desirable to have experience in Qatar and/or the Gulf region.
